We use ISA Server 2004 to publish Outlook Web Access of Exchange Server 2003 with Form based authentication. Sometimes, our Exchange Server is offline while we apply operating system updates or Exchange specific hotfixes.
If a user tries to log on to Outlook Web Access while the Exchange Server is offline, he or she gets an error message stating that the Exchange Server can’t be reached. That message appears after the user pressed the Log On Button as the Logon mask is provided by ISA Server.
Although we announce those maintenance works, people often call help desk why they can’t logon to Outlook Web Access.
Is it possible to temporary redirect the OWA page to a static page announcing the maintenance works without time consuming modifying the ISA Server rules?
